Assessment of decisional balance for regular physical exercise: Adaptation and validation of the Decisional Balance Scale for Exercise among a French sample

2013 
a b s t r a c t Objective. - The purpose of this study was to validate a French version of the Decisional Balance Scale for Exercise (BDAP) and to examine its psychometric properties as well as its relationship with the three other components of Transtheoritical Model (TTM). Participants and method. - Four hundred and six subjects (270 women), aged between 16 to 65 years old, fulfilled BDAP and other questionnaires measuring the three other components of TTM (Stages of Change of Exercise Behavior Scale, Exercise Processes of Change Questionnaire, Exercise Confidence Survey). Results. - Confirmatory factor analyses supported the two-factor model of BDAP (pros, ! = 0.85 and cons, ! = 0.73) assumed in the MTT. A good test-retest reliability was observed. BDAP was associated with the three other components of TTM. Conclusion. - The French version of the BDAP shows good structural and psychometric properties. BDAP may be used as a valid tool in French-speaking populations.
